本発明は建築工事等のコンクリ−1・打ちの際に使用す
るコンクリート打設用型枠に関する。DETAILED DESCRIPTION OF THE INVENTION [Field of Industrial Application] The present invention relates to a formwork for concrete pouring used in pouring concrete in construction work and the like.
この種の型枠として要望される性質は、軽量で変形し難
り、かつコンクリートとの剥離が良いことである。とこ
ろで、従来使用されていた型枠の−a的なものは金属製
のものであるが、コンクリートとの剥離が悪く、そのた
めにコンクリートとの接触面に油を塗布する等の手間と
材料がかかり、また、表面に複雑な凹凸模様を形成する
ような場合には型枠そのものの製造に相当な費用がかか
るという欠点があった。The desired properties of this type of formwork are that it is lightweight, difficult to deform, and has good peelability from concrete. By the way, the conventionally used type of formwork is made of metal, but it does not peel easily from the concrete, so it takes time and materials such as applying oil to the contact surface with the concrete. In addition, when a complicated uneven pattern is to be formed on the surface, there is a drawback that the manufacturing cost of the formwork itself is considerable.
そこで、近年、金属製元型(金型)にシリコンゴム、ネ
オプレーンゴム等のゴム材を流し込んで製作したゴム製
型枠が開発された。この型枠はコンクリートとの剥離が
良好で、複雑な凹凸模様も成形し易いという利点がある
が、しかし、凹凸模様が大きくなる、すなわち凹部と凸
部の差が大きくなると、型枠としての厚味を大きくしな
ければならない。厚味が大きくなると重量が相当なもの
となり、作業の困難性が生じるという欠点があり、また
コストも高くなるという欠点が生じた。Therefore, in recent years, a rubber formwork has been developed that is manufactured by pouring a rubber material such as silicone rubber or neoprene rubber into a metal master mold (mold). This formwork has the advantage of good peeling from concrete and the ability to easily form complex uneven patterns. The flavor has to be big. As the thickness increases, the weight becomes considerable, which has the disadvantage of making work difficult and increasing the cost.
本発明はこれ等の欠点を改善すべく、複雑で凹凸の大き
い模様でも容易に製作できると共に重量は軽く、またコ
ンクリートとの剥離も容易に行え、かつコストの安価な
コンクリート打設用型枠を提供することを目的とするも
のである。In order to improve these drawbacks, the present invention provides a formwork for concrete pouring that can be easily produced even with complex and highly uneven patterns, is light in weight, can be easily separated from concrete, and is inexpensive. The purpose is to provide
1はABS樹脂等の成形容易な合成樹脂を空圧成形ある
いはプレス成形により所望の表面形状(本実施例では三
角形状の凸出部1a)に形成した基体である。この基1
体1は全体の厚味が略均−に形成され、しかも比較的厚
味が薄いので変形しないように補強用のリブ1bが裏面
に一体形成されている。2は基体1の表面にスプレーガ
ンにより、あるいは、ドブ清等により塗布したガラスレ
ジンである。Reference numeral 1 denotes a base body made of easily moldable synthetic resin such as ABS resin, which is formed into a desired surface shape (triangular convex portion 1a in this embodiment) by pneumatic molding or press molding. This group 1
The body 1 has a substantially uniform overall thickness and is relatively thin, so reinforcing ribs 1b are integrally formed on the back surface to prevent deformation. 2 is a glass resin applied to the surface of the substrate 1 by a spray gun, a drain cleaner, or the like.
而して、このように形成した型枠は、これを利用して枠
組し、しかる後にコンクリートを流し込むと、コンクリ
ートとの接触面がガラスレジン2であることからして、
コンクリートの硬化後に、該コンクリートとの剥離が非
常に良く、しかもガラスレジン2が非常に平滑面である
ので、剥離後のコンクリート表面に光沢が生じ、従って
、後工程で行われる塗装において、塗料の塗布量が少な
くてすみ、作業性の向上と材料費の削減を図ることがで
きるものである。また、ガラスレジン2は硬質であるこ
とから傷が付き難く、従って繰り返しの使用にもコンク
リートとの剥離は良好に行え〔発明の効果〕
本発明は前記したように、ABS樹脂のような比較的軟
質の合成樹脂であっても、表面にガラスレジンを塗布す
ることにより、合成樹脂のみを型枠として利用した場合
のように、繰り返しの使用によっても表面に傷が付くよ
うなことがないので、長期間の繰り返し使用にもコンク
リートとの剥離が良く、また合成樹脂の基体であること
から型枠としてのコストの低減と軽量化が図れると共に
複雑な表面形状の型枠も容易に製作でき、しかもコンク
リート表面に光沢が生じるので、後工程の塗装が容易で
塗料の削減も図れる等の効果を有するものである。Therefore, when the formwork formed in this way is used to frame and then concrete is poured, since the contact surface with the concrete is the glass resin 2,
After the concrete hardens, the peeling from the concrete is very good, and since the glass resin 2 has a very smooth surface, the surface of the concrete after peeling becomes glossy, and therefore, in the painting performed in the later process, the paint does not peel off easily. The amount of coating required is small, improving workability and reducing material costs. In addition, since the glass resin 2 is hard, it is hard to be scratched, and therefore it can be easily peeled from concrete even after repeated use. Even if it is a soft synthetic resin, by coating the surface with glass resin, the surface will not be scratched even after repeated use, unlike when only synthetic resin is used as a formwork. It peels well from concrete even after repeated use over a long period of time, and since it has a synthetic resin base, it is possible to reduce the cost and weight of formwork, and it is also possible to easily produce formwork with complex surface shapes. Since the surface of the concrete becomes glossy, it is easy to paint in the subsequent process and the amount of paint can be reduced.
